Free two-day shipping rewired what customers expect from delivery, and it blew a hole in last-mile budgets that retailers are still scrambling to patch. FarEye, an AI-Powered Delivery Management System (DMS), recently launched an agentic AI dispatcher called PILOT to plan, execute, and monitor final-mile deliveries with minimal human oversight.

Gaurav Srivastava, the company’s co-founder and chief product and technology officer, told FreightWaves two forces made the launch possible: relentless consumer demand for free, fast delivery, and the leap in AI capability that followed Large Language Models (LLMs) debut.

“The two big drivers of AI: first is what we call the Amazon Prime effect,” Srivastava said. “Every consumer wants things to be delivered free and fast, and that poses a big challenge for retailers and carriers across the world.” That demand lands hardest on the last mile, the final leg between a warehouse or store and a customer’s door.

It is also the most expensive. The Amazon Prime Effect Meets a Cost Problem Last-mile delivery consumes 40% of total supply chain cost, Srivastava said, more than any other segment of the network. It is also the most fragmented, with decision-making absorbed daily by a single, overworked role.

“The dispatcher is the person sitting there locally in the city, managing your drivers, managing that chaos of a driver not showing up, a truck running into an accident, a shipment running late, a customer’s urgent call,” Srivastava said. “All of that is absorbed by this one persona, that one human. His entire day goes by firefighting.”

FarEye has worked with dispatchers for over 10 years, Srivastava said. Agentic AI opened a new possibility: an agent that works alongside the dispatcher instead of just handing them another screen to click through.

Inside FarEye’s Agentic AI Dispatcher PILOT covers what a dispatcher normally handles across a 10-hour shift: scrubbing order data, planning routes, sourcing carriers and drivers, handing off shipments, and monitoring the day as problems surface. It can run autonomously or with a human reviewing its calls.

“This agent can proactively plan, execute, and also monitor your last-mile operations,” Srivastava said. The system is built to be modular, and sits on top of the enterprise’s (FarEye or otherwise) existing route optimization, compliance, and track-and-trace tools, all integrated into one decision layer.

Working in a Human-In-The-Loop (HITL) model, it ensures the required human oversight while reserving human interception for critical exceptions. For carriers and shippers, that means fewer decisions routed through one overworked person’s judgment, and more routed through a system that never stops watching the board.

On the contrary, enabling the dispatcher to drive sharper decisions with up to five times higher productivity. Right Truck, Right Price, Right Time Srivastava pointed to Tractor Supply, which operates more than 2,400 stores nationwide and ships everything from a hammer to livestock feed, as an example of the orchestration problem AI is built to solve.

The retailer runs its own trucks but also leans on FedEx, UPS, and regional providers. “There are days their trucks would sit idle at the store with just under 50% capacity while the store ships out products with FedEx and UPS,” Srivastava said. “And then there are days where their trucks aren’t able to fulfill all orders.”

The agent decides, order by order, where capacity should go. “Even if it’s very close to your store, you might still want to give it away to a FedEx or UPS because it’s more cost-effective,” Srivastava said. “Your cost of driving that big truck just to deliver one small hammer might not be a great use of your assets.”

That decision runs on live, dynamic cost data, not a fixed rulebook. “Should it be loaded on your truck? Should it be loaded on a small van? Should it be given to a FedEx or a Roadie or an Uber?” Srivastava said. “Or should it just be deferred to tomorrow because there’s no SLA breach?”

Srivastava said the problem is harder in last-mile than in middle-mile trucking, where networks run between fixed nodes. “In last-mile you don’t have nodes. You don’t know where you’ll be delivering,” he said. “You can get a delivery from a very remote suburban ZIP code you have never serviced before, and now you’ve got to create a plan for it.

That problem vastly more complex.” Omnichannel Growth Outpaces the Store The shift shows up in retailers’ own strategy. Enterprises like Tractor Supply spent years trying to pull customers into its stores, Srivastava said. That has changed.

“Until about two years ago, Enterprises had this strategy that they wanted to drive customers to their offline store,” he said. “That strategy has evolved now. They want to be present wherever the customer would find it most convenient, whether in store or to order online and get it delivered.
